Following the route of an ancient indian trail that linked the clatsop and tillamook people, highway 101 was opened over the treacherous headland of neahkahnie mountain in 1940.

The oregon coast scenic railroad ocsr is a steampowered heritage railroad, a 501c3 nonprofit organization, operating in oregon, primarily between garibaldi and rockaway beach, with additional special trips to wheeler, nehalem river and into the salmonberry river canyon. Scenic oregon 1943 approved 9min documentary, short 26 june 1943 usa this traveltalks entry takes the viewer to oregon, focusing on natural and manmade attractions including bonneville dam, celilo falls, and salmon fishing along the columbia river.
